work out 4/9 + 2/9 and simplify where possible (it isnt 6/9)

Respuesta :

Аноним Аноним
  • 02-07-2020

Answer:

2/3

Step-by-step explanation:

4/9+2/9=6/9

then you have to reduce/simply your answer more from 6/9

divide each number by 3 and that with give you your answer 2/3.

6÷3=2 and 9÷3=3

Adding fractions with same denominator
